SPIDER MAN 3 - SPIDER-MAN 3 REMAINS TOP OF U.K. BOX OFFICE
SPIDER-MAN 3 has taken top spot in the U.K. box office chart for a second week.
The third installment of the Spider-Man franchise took GBP5.6 million ($11.2 million) over the weekend (11-12May07), adding to the GBP11.8 million ($23.6 million) it took on its first weekend.
28 Weeks Later, the sequel to zombie thriller 28 Days Later, made its debut at number two - followed by Bridge To Terabithia in third place.
Road trip movie Wild Hogs stayed at number four after taking GBP317,000 ($634,000) over the weekend and former chart-topper Mr Bean's Holiday is at number five, taking its total to GBP21.4 million ($42.8 million).
Nicolas Cage's film Next fell to sixth, with courtroom drama Fracture following in seventh place.
